Chapter 108 Night Raid on the Imperial Palace
At night, a dark shadow flashed by on the west side of the Xuanyuan Imperial Palace.
It was Li Wei.
He concealed his presence, leaped onto a tree in the courtyard, and lay in wait.
Human cultivators were extremely rare in this era; most were either leaders of various tribes or high-ranking henchmen.
Even if they are unhappy in their own tribe, they will be recruited by other tribes at high prices.
As the number one tribe of the human race, the Xuanyuan tribe has many cultivators, all of whom hold high positions.
Of course, he would not become the emperor's bodyguard or even a palace eunuch.
Therefore, the patrol personnel in the palace are all ordinary people, at most martial arts practitioners, so of course they cannot detect him.
As for the two beauties, Li Wei had already hypnotized them with ethereal music played on his ocarina.
Although his musical skills are far from being as miraculous as Yaoyue's, they are more than enough to deal with ordinary people.
After waiting for a moment in the tree, another dark figure flew up to the branch and stood next to him.
It is the shadow of the sunflower.
He had communicated with his adopted sister by telepathy during the day and confirmed that she also had a way to make the maids fall asleep, so they agreed to meet in the tree that night.
"Brother, should we go directly to the Emperor's palace to investigate?" Zhong Kui asked telepathically.
During these four months, because Li Wei had been helping her answer the questions she encountered in practicing the "All Laws Return to Nothingness" technique, the two of them were no longer as reserved as they had been at the beginning.
Ever since Li Wei was formally adopted as a son by the Queen Mother of the West, Zhong Kuiying has been calling him "elder brother".
Li Wei also called her "Ying'er," no longer adding the honorific "Your Highness."
Li Wei even told her his real name, but he hadn't shown her his face yet.
After all, Xie Youshan's concerns were justified.
According to later legends, this girl was destined to enter some kind of demon's tomb. Whether she fell in love with him or he fell in love with her, it would only end in tragedy.
Forget about falling in love, even now that he's calling her his brother, Li Wei is already thinking about how to prevent her from entering the Demon Tomb.
"No, the Human Emperor is a Heavenly Mandate cultivator. Although his strength may not be great, his realm is there, and it's hard for us not to be detected."
"Although the other party claims to be seriously ill, who knows what the actual situation is? It's best not to disturb him rashly."
"Let's investigate whether there are any basements or similar places inside this palace."
Ever since Li Wei had a sudden inspiration at his third uncle's house and discovered the Shadow Assassins' hideout, he has had an obsession with the underground.
Actually, he is absolutely right to think that way.
Anything dishonorable or that needs to be kept secret is definitely hidden underground; it's impossible for it to be displayed for others to see.
And it can't be hidden too far away, otherwise it would be too inconvenient.
That means it's not just the basement of your own house, is it?
Even his own residence has a basement, doesn't it?
"Alright, I'll take charge of the east side, brother, you scout the west side." Zhong Kuiying nodded in agreement, then used his lightness skill to drift eastward.
Li Wei also started from where he was and began to explore the western palace of the entire palace complex.
Ji Youguang had a Crown Prince's residence outside the palace, so Li Wei was not worried about being seen by him.
Actually, it was thanks to Kunlun's status that they were directly placed in the palace; otherwise, they would never have been allowed to enter the palace.
The thought that Ji Youguang was the crown prince made Li Wei laugh.
There's a saying from a past life: Throughout history, has there ever been a crown prince who reigned for forty years?
According to Ji Youguang, he sought enlightenment in Kunlun eight hundred years ago, so he must have been the crown prince for eight hundred years.
From this perspective, the appearance of the heavenly tribulation seems somewhat reasonable.
Later emperors generally abdicated before the age of one hundred, handing the throne to their successors and going into seclusion to improve their cultivation, so as not to fail even the first tribulation.
These old emperors thus became part of the imperial heritage.
They generally do not participate in the struggle for the crown prince, but if any outsider dares to rebel, they will strike hard.
Simply put, it doesn't matter as long as the throne remains in the hands of one's descendants.
If non-royal members want to rebel, they must take into account the fighting strength of these old royals.
Within the royal family, the rule was that those with martial virtue resided there.
This is also why Long Yin was more wary of the Prince of Zhenbei than of the State of Wei.
As a member of the imperial clan, the Prince of Zhenbei could have easily engaged in a mutual exchange with him with the tacit approval of his ancestors.
Just like Long Yin and his second brother used to fight each other.
In this era, the resources for longevity have not yet been exhausted, and even a cultivator like Ji Yuanhong, who is destined for immortality, can live for thousands of years.
This caused him to cling tightly to the throne and refuse to let go.
Li Wei found it hard to imagine how twisted Ji Youguang's mind would have become after being the crown prince for eight hundred years.
Therefore, he was very suspicious of Ji Youguang.
Could it be that he poisoned Ji Yuanhong, then claimed that Ji Yuanhong was bedridden due to illness, thus inciting other tribes to invade, and in turn tricked the Kunlun envoy into announcing his support for him in front of the people?
Even if he lacks the strength, with Kunlun's endorsement, he can still secure his position as tribal leader and even human emperor.
However, these are all speculations, and it is still difficult to say what Ji Yuanhong's current situation is.
Li Wei made his way from south to north, scanning the underground with his divine sense, but avoiding only the Emperor's palace.
The palace was really too small. There were only four sections on the west side, and the size of the palace was much smaller than in later times. Li Wei quickly finished his inspection.
No underground palace was found.
He turned back to the courtyard where he was temporarily staying and waited in the tree.
It was quite a while before Zhong Kuiying returned.
"An underground cavity has been discovered, but it is heavily guarded by soldiers."
Li Wei thought for a moment and then brought up the system panel.
Focus your mind on the section for available training methods.
[To learn the fifth-tier skill "Never Think of Returning" to perfection, it requires 25600 recharge points. Do you wish to learn it?]
"yes!"
[Ding! 17920 recharge points (10% discount) have been deducted, and the fifth-tier skill "No Thoughts of Return" has been mastered!]
Although he only has a little over 50,000 recharge points left, he believes in the saying "you can't catch a wolf without risking your cub."
You must not hesitate to use your recharge points when necessary.
He then had Zhong Kuiying lead the way to the palace where the underground cavern was discovered.
Upon arriving at the location, Li Wei discovered that it was actually the ancestral hall of the Xuanyuan clan.
He silently apologized to himself, then took out his ocarina.
After a moment of preparation, he began to play.
Although this fifth-level musical technique still hasn't reached the "great sound is silent" realm that Yaoyue mentioned, it's truly a dimensional reduction attack against these mortals.
Moreover, the direction and distance of the flute music were within Li Wei's control, so there was no need to worry about alerting the guards elsewhere.
He incorporated techniques to soothe emotions and soften wills into the flute music.
The guards, already exhausted from standing guard at night, were so captivated by the sound of the ocarina that their first reaction wasn't to be on alert.
Li Wei gave them a hint with his flute: ignore everything else, close your eyes and listen carefully to this beautiful music.
Then, he swaggered past the guards with Zhong Kuiying in tow.
The special effect of this fifth-order musical technique, "Never Think of Returning Home," is "Lingering Sound."
Even after Li Wei stopped playing, the soldiers remained captivated by the music that didn't exist in reality, unable to extricate themselves.
Zhong Kuiying, who was standing to the side, watched with her eyes shining, thinking that Li Wei's move was simply divine.
However, in Li Wei's opinion, this method was still a bit rigid. If he could become invisible like Aunt Ying, why would he need to go through all this trouble?
